About

Julien Cayron is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Ecology and Molecular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Julien Cayron has authored 10 papers receiving a total of 340 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Molecular Biology, 4 papers in Ecology and 4 papers in Molecular Medicine. Recurrent topics in Julien Cayron's work include Bacterial Genetics and Biotechnology (4 papers), Antibiotic Resistance in Bacteria (4 papers) and Bacterial biofilms and quorum sensing (3 papers). Julien Cayron is often cited by papers focused on Bacterial Genetics and Biotechnology (4 papers), Antibiotic Resistance in Bacteria (4 papers) and Bacterial biofilms and quorum sensing (3 papers). Julien Cayron collaborates with scholars based in France and Belgium. Julien Cayron's co-authors include Christian Lesterlin, Annick Berne-Dedieu, Adeline Page, Frédéric Delolme, Sophie Nolivos, Agnès Rodrigue, Erwan Gueguen, Elsa Prudent, David Pignol and Daniel Garcia and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Journal of Molecular Biology and Science Advances.
